Hyatt Hotels

Hyatt Hotels is a global hospitality company that operates a portfolio of over 1,000 hotels and resorts in 67 countries. The company’s brands include Hyatt Regency, Grand Hyatt, Park Hyatt, Hyatt House, and Hyatt Place.

Hilton Worldwide

Hilton Worldwide is another global hospitality company that operates a portfolio of over 6,000 hotels and resorts in 117 countries. The company’s brands include Hilton Hotels & Resorts, Waldorf Astoria Hotels & Resorts, Conrad Hotels & Resorts, and Hampton by Hilton.
